How Life Works Here

Lower Court is located in Broxtowe, near Beeston, Nottinghamshire. Crime is around average for the area, with 114 incidents in the past year. The most commonly reported category is violence and sexual offences. Violent offences account for 43% of reported crimes. Some amenities are available nearby, though a car may be useful for regular errands like grocery shopping. Transport connections are strong, with rail and bus and tram links nearby. The nearest stop (Salthouse Lane) is 130m away. Properties here change hands infrequently. The local area has a moderate population, with a high proportion of rented accommodation. There are 3 schools within 2 km, 3 rated Good or Outstanding by Ofsted. Primary schools are nearby, though secondary options may require travel. The area sits within Flood Zone 2 (river flooding), indicating medium flood risk. It is worth checking the Environment Agency flood map for current details. This street may particularly suit young professionals. Overall, this street scores 54 out of 100 for liveability, above the district average.
